HTML input标签属性详解:text、password、file、hidden及更多
需积分: 47 187 浏览量
更新于2024-09-16
1
收藏 4KB TXT 举报
"input标签的属性大全,包括text、password、hidden、button、file、checkbox等多种类型及其详细说明"
在HTML中,`<input>`标签是非常关键的一部分,它用于创建各种用户交互元素。以下是对各个属性的详细解释:
1. `type=text`
- 这是`<input>`标签最常用的类型,用于创建文本输入框。用户可以在这里输入任意文本。
- `name`属性用于标识输入字段,便于在服务器端或JavaScript中引用。
- `size`定义了输入框的宽度,以字符数为单位。
- `maxlength`限制了用户输入的最大字符数。
- `value`设置输入框的初始值。
- `readonly`属性使输入框变为只读,用户不能修改其内容。
2. `type=password`
- 此类型用于创建密码输入框,输入的内容会以星号或圆点显示,保护用户的隐私。
- 其他属性如`name`、`size`、`maxlength`和`value`与`type=text`相同。
3. `type=file`
- 这种类型的`<input>`允许用户选择本地文件上传到服务器。
- `size`定义了选择文件按钮的宽度。
- `name`属性用于识别上传的文件,在服务器端处理时使用。
4. `type=hidden`
- 隐藏字段不显示在页面上,但其值可以被提交到服务器。常用于存储用户不可见的数据。
5. `type=button`
- 创建一个普通按钮,不执行任何内置操作,需要通过JavaScript来定义按钮点击后的动作,如打开新窗口或触发其他事件。
6. `type=checkbox`
- 复选框,用户可以选择多个选项。`name`属性用于标识一组相关的复选框,`value`定义了选中时发送到服务器的值。`checked`属性默认勾选复选框。
以上是`<input>`标签的一些常见类型及其属性。这些属性可以帮助开发者创建丰富的用户界面,收集用户数据,以及实现各种交互功能。在实际应用中,还可以结合CSS进行样式定制,以及使用JavaScript进行更复杂的交互逻辑控制。理解并熟练运用这些属性对于前端开发来说至关重要。
2020-10-20 上传
2021-01-08 上传
2023-11-17 上传
点击了解资源详情
2023-09-09 上传
2023-10-18 上传
2023-05-20 上传
2023-06-03 上传
2023-08-26 上传
nihaoma14743
- 粉丝: 0
- 资源: 3
最新资源
- 构建基于Django和Stripe的SaaS应用教程
- Symfony2框架打造的RESTful问答系统icare-server
- 蓝桥杯Python试题解析与答案题库
- Go语言实现NWA到WAV文件格式转换工具
- 基于Django的医患管理系统应用
- Jenkins工作流插件开发指南:支持Workflow Python模块
- Java红酒网站项目源码解析与系统开源介绍
- Underworld Exporter资产定义文件详解
- Java版Crash Bandicoot资源库:逆向工程与源码分享
- Spring Boot Starter 自动IP计数功能实现指南
- 我的世界牛顿物理学模组深入解析
- STM32单片机工程创建详解与模板应用
- GDG堪萨斯城代码实验室:离子与火力基地示例应用
- Android Capstone项目:实现Potlatch服务器与OAuth2.0认证
- Cbit类:简化计算封装与异步任务处理
- Java8兼容的FullContact API Java客户端库介绍